基于OTSU的动态结合全局阈值的图像分割

摘要
动态结合全局阈值的图像分割方法,在图像灰度分布没有明显双峰及背景复杂的情况下也有很好的适应性。 用OTSU方法求得近红外图像的全局阈值s和各子图像的阈值d;利用双线性内插值算法求得与原图像 等大的阈值矩阵D。通过调整比例系数k,最后完成阈值矩阵T的构造和图像分割。此方法能有效分割出石化炼油炉的炉管图像。
Abstract
In the case of image gray distribution without significant double peaks and the complex background, the dynamic image segmentation method combined with global threshold has good adaptability. The global threshold of near-infrared image s, and the threshold value of the small-block images d are evaluated by the method of OTSU, and the threshold matrix D with the original image by the bilinear interpolation algorithm. Finally, the structure of threshold matrix T and segmentation of image are completed by adjusting the scale coefficient k. This method can effectively split images of the furnace tube in petrochemical refinery.
